What Is Keyword Velocity in SEO?

What Is Keyword Velocity in SEO?

The speed and direction of ranking change across your keyword set — often the earliest signal that something is working, or breaking.

Keyword velocity is the rate at which your tracked keywords gain or lose positions over time — a leading indicator of algo updates and content decay — LemRank.

Frequently asked questions

What is a good keyword velocity?

Sustained positive velocity across a keyword cluster indicates your topical authority is compounding. A sudden negative spike across many unrelated keywords usually means an algorithm update.

How is velocity different from position?

Position is a snapshot. Velocity is the derivative — how fast that snapshot is changing. Two sites both at position 8 can have opposite futures if one is climbing and the other falling.

Why is velocity flat for some keywords?

Low-volume or highly stable SERPs (branded queries, thin-competition long-tails) simply don't move much day to day. Flat velocity there is a good sign.
